DDX3X induces mesenchymal transition of endothelial cells by disrupting BMPR2 signaling
Elevated DDX3X expression led to downregulation of BMPR2, a key regulator of endothelial homeostasis and function. Our co‐immunoprecipitation assays further demonstrated a molecular interaction between DDX3X and BMPR2. Notably, DDX3X promoted lysosomal degradation of BMPR2, thereby impairing its downstream signaling and facilitating endothelial‐to ...

Instability and `Sausage-String' Appearance in Blood Vessels during High Blood Pressure [PDF]
A new Rayleigh-type instability is proposed to explain the `sausage-string' pattern of alternating constrictions and dilatations formed in blood vessels under influence of a vasoconstricting agent.

Promiscuous stimulation of HSP70 ATPase activity by parasite‐derived J‐domains
The malaria parasite Plasmodium falciparum exports three highly homologous yet functionally divergent J‐domain proteins into human erythrocytes. Here, we show that J‐domains isolated from all three proteins effectively stimulate the ATPase activity of both endogenous host and exported parasite HSP70 chaperones.
